Latest Patents
One of Nakase's latest patents is a method for removing phosphorus from phosphorus-containing substances. This innovative approach is applicable on an industrial scale and effectively reduces phosphorus levels in materials used for metal smelting or refining. The method involves reacting the phosphorus-containing substance with a nitrogen-containing gas at a treatment temperature lower than the melting temperature of the substance. This process allows phosphorus to be removed preferably in the form of phosphorus nitride (PN). Additionally, the nitrogen and oxygen partial pressures in the gas are controlled to minimize the load on the dephosphorization process.
Another notable patent by Nakase is a method for oxygen-blowing refining of molten iron. In this method, an oxygen-containing gas is supplied from an inlet side of a blowing nozzle, which passes through the outer shell of a top-blowing lance. The gas is blown from the nozzle while a control gas is jetted toward the inside of the nozzle during part of the refining process. This innovative design enhances the efficiency of the refining process.
